Description
10 Kreuzer from County of Tyrol. Issued in 1571. Struck in Silver (.930). Measures 27 mm and weighs 3.63 g.
- Obverse
- Crowned armoured bust facing right, sceptre at right hand, within a smooth circle. Legend around (starts 1h) divided by the crown. Value between D and G below.
- Reverse
- Composite arms in a shield including 1 Hungary, 2 Bohemia, 3 composition of Castilla and León, 4 of Austria and Burgundy. Double circle, the outermost beaded. Legend around starts 1h. Date above the shield.
